But, it is a shocking statement. You pay less tax on the first dollars of earnings and better tax on your private last usd. Let us assume you are single and your taxable income covers to $45,000 during yr. Then you pay federal tax in the rate of 10 percent on the $8,350 of taxable income. The other 15% imposed on income between $8,350 and $33,950. 25% is charged on income from $33,950 to $45,000.

You will have to explain to the IRS that you were insolvent during approach of settlement. The best way to perform so is to fill the internal revenue service form 982: Reduction of Tax Attributes Due to discharge of Indebtedness. Alternately, specialists . also fasten a letter making use of tax return giving actions break from the total debts as well as the total assets that you would have. If you don't address 1099-C from the IRS, the government will file a Federal tax Lien and actions end up being taken an individual in type of interests and penalties could be aching!
